A mother-of-two who went from heavily pregnant to svelte within two months has posted incredible pictures of her transformation.

Fitness guru Tammy Hembrow, from Queensland, shared the photos with her four million Instagram followers as she paid homage to the ‘incredible power’ of the human body.

The photos show how she turned her baby bump into a taut tummy with a dedicated regime of diet and exercise.

Ms Hembrow shared the photos to show other pregnant women that it is possible to regain their pre-baby bodies with a bit of hard work.

‘It’s truly incredible what the human body can do,’ she wrote underneath a photo posted two months after birth.

‘It’s so important to love yourself and your body at every stage in your life.

‘Every body is different and you should never compare yourself to others.

‘But if you give your body the love, exercise, and nutrition it deserves, you will reap the rewards.’

A striking before and after photo illustrated how the Queensland-based fitness coach began toning up after birth when she was not allowed to exercise.

The photos show how she slowly regained muscle tone in her tummy and legs through a slight change in diet.

‘The before photos were taken when I first got home from hospital a few days after the birth and the after photos were taken just over a week ago at three weeks postpartum,’ she explained.

‘I’m not allowed to workout yet but I’ve been eating clean and I trained throughout my entire pregnancy except for the last couple of weeks as I had some complications.’

Although many women give up hope of regaining their pre-baby bodies, Ms Hembrow planned to get into better shape than ever.

‘I’ve lost a lot of muscle but I’m pretty happy with my postpartum body so far,’ she added.

‘So many women think you can’t get your body back after pregnancy but this just isn’t true.

‘I can’t wait to start training again in a few weeks and get my body into the best shape it’s ever been in.’ 

Ms Hembrow is a lifestyle guru who specialises in diet and workout plans.
